Remove .owner field if calls are used which set it automatically.
./drivers/platform/x86/amd/hfi/hfi.c:512:3-8: No need to set .owner here. The core will do it.

On Fri, 25 Jul 2025, Jiapeng Chong wrote: > Remove .owner field if calls are used which set it automatically. This changelog is too confusing, please improve. You state "if calls are used which set it automatically", are they used or not? Preferrably name the call. Please don't leave things like that hanging into air. > ./drivers/platform/x86/amd/hfi/hfi.c:512:3-8: No need to set .owner here. The core will do it. This looks like an error/warning message from something?
